Unresponsive woman found in car at Grant Beach pavilionSpringfield MO

audio iconMedical Emergency
Grant Beach, Springfield, MO

A woman was found unresponsive in a white Mustang with Oklahoma plates at Grant Beach Pavilion. The caller reported she did not respond when honked at and the car door was open.
